Some of you may have heard about our recent funding success.  We, along with
researchers at the UC San Francisco and Merck were awarded $25million over five
years to work towards finding a cure for HIV.  Our joint project with UCSF
was one of three such awards funded by the NIH.  Each research team will
use the funds for research efforts directly devoted to finding a cure for
HIV.
